Rabu, 28 Maret 2012

BAGAIMANA KOMPUTER MENAMPILKAN TAMPILAN DI MONITOR

Komputer merupakan peralatan elektronik yang sudah biasa di gunakan dari anak-anak, orang dewasa sampai lansia. Sebelum tahun 2000 an, komputer masih menjadi barang mewah dimana harganya masih mahal, namun sekarang komputer relatif terjangkau harganya, sehingga tidak heran jika anak SMP sudah terbiasa menggunakan laptop/notebook untuk belajar di sekolah.

Sebagai barang elektronik, yang membedakan komputer dengan barang elektonik lain adalah:
  1. Terdiri dari perangkat keras/hardware dan perangkat lunak/software.
  2. Bekerja berdasarkan kode perintah/script program
  3. Mempunyai media penyimpanan, baik penyimpanan sementara (RAM) dan penyimpan permanen (hardisk).
  4. Dapat menerima masukan dan memprosesnya, selanjutnya menjadikan keluaran/output.
  5. Bekerja secara otomatis.

Apa yang membedakan Komputer dengan TV ? jika di lihat sekilas keduanya sama-sama menampilkan gambar, bahkan komputer bisa di gunakan sebagai TV jika ada perangkat tambahannya. Dibawah ini penulis mencoba menerangkan tentang komputer di ditinjau dari segi software/pemrograman, sehingga komputer bisa menampilkan gambar. Penulis tidak menjelaskan dari sisi elektoniknya. Selain itu penulis menggunakan bahasa yang mudah di pahami (tidak terlalu jauh ke bahasa komputer).
Dibawah ini adalah diskripsi gambar  output/monitor komputer. 

Layar monitor terdiri dari ribuan titik atau pixel, semakin banyak pixelnya maka gambarnya semakin halus. Gambar di atas adalah gambaran pixel yang terlihat angka 0 dan 1 yang membentuk huruf HI, angka 0 berarti mati dan angka 1 berarti menyala. Untuk membangkitkan tulisan HI maka menggunakan kode program. Secara mendasar bahasa program komputer adalah 0 dan 1 ( mati – nyala / of – on). Sehingga untuk menampilkan Tulisan HI di pixel adalah menggunakan bahasa program yang mengatur terjadinya mati dan nyala pixel di monitor.

Penjelasan diatas adalah gambaran yang sangat sederhana dari komputer. Jika kita bandingkan dengan tampilan komputer yang sudah berbentuk grafis dan gambar, tentunya penjelasan tersebut masih jauh. Untuk membahas tersebut ada beberapa yang perlu di jelaskan dan di pahami, diantaranya :
  1. Tingkat bahasa pemrograman dari dari bahasa tingkat rendah sampai tinggi.
  2. Bilangan Biner (0,1) dan Oktal(0,1,2,...7) dan Hexa (0,1,2,....F)
  3. Sistem digital
  4. Memori (bit, byte,kb, Mb, Gb)
  5. Logika dan algoritma program
  6. dll.

Untuk tulisan selanjutnya semoga penulis bisa membahas poin-poin diatas dengan bahasa yang semudah dan sesederhana mungkin. 


Tidak ada komentar:

Posting Komentar